Ron Howard Joins Burns Film Center Board

Written by: FFT Webmaster | July 29th, 2011

Academy Award-winning filmmaker Ron Howard (A BEAUTIFUL MIND) has been elected to the Board of Directors of the Jacob Burns Film Center (JBFC), the non-profit film and education institution in Westchester County north of New York City. Howard is a local resident who has been involved with the Center since its beginnings a decade ago. In 2005, he was the recipient of the Center’s first Vision Award. JBFC not only provides a 365-day calendar of film screenings but also offers intensive educational and training programs for professionals and students aspiring to enter the industry. In addition to his role on the JBFC board, Howard and his wife Cheryl serve as co-chairs of the JBFC’s Tribute to Steven Spielberg, a fundraiser to be held on Saturday, September 17, with proceeds going to support the Center’s education and outreach programs.
